One of the most enchanting features of Hunt County is its rich architectural heritage, particularly the Early American architectural style that graces many of its homes. This style, characterized by its symmetry, classic proportions, and timeless elegance, reflects the historical roots of American design. As you stroll through the neighborhoods, you’ll find charming homes with steeply pitched roofs, decorative gables, and inviting front porches that beckon you to sit and enjoy the scenery. These homes not only provide a glimpse into the past but also offer modern comforts that cater to today’s homeowner.
